gpt4 book ai didi

javascript - 在某个点停止/禁用垂直滚动,但能够向上滚动页面但不能向下滚动

转载 作者:行者123 更新时间:2023-11-27 23:15:06 26 4
gpt4 key购买 nike

我制作了一个具有水平和垂直滚动功能的游戏网站,但我希望该网站在“第二个箭头”处停止或禁用向下滚动页面,但能够向上滚动页面。

基本上我已经尝试过“overflow-y:hidden”,但我仍然希望能够向上滚动页面

https://codepen.io/54x1/full/qBBdXGP

查看我的代码笔以查看我的设计

我想要的代码:

var BotOfWin1 = $(window).scrollTop() + $(window).outerHeight();
var BotOfObj1 = $('.main-rules').position().top + $('.main-rules').outerHeight();
if (BotOfWin1 > BotOfObj1)
{
$('.game-section').css({"display": "block"});
} else {
$('.game-section').css({"display": "none"});
}

最佳答案

我不知道您禁止在第二个箭头下方滚动的动机(除了滚动之外,用户可以导航到那里吗?)。所以我只是假设,您只是想阻止用户到达那里。

只需在 CSS 中使用 display: none 即可不显示内容。

关于javascript - 在某个点停止/禁用垂直滚动,但能够向上滚动页面但不能向下滚动,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58301346/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com